She took 5 weeks of Infant Swimming Resource swim lessons which are survival swimming lessons where they teach infants and young children basically how to roll onto their back rest, float, and breath. It was fun to watch her progress from not knowing what to do to floating all by herself. She still needs a lot of practice but I do really like knowing that she has the life saving skill of floating on her back.
